Massachusetts Life Producer Exam Preparation

Becoming a licensed life producer in the state of Massachusetts requires passing the Life Producer Exam — a comprehensive test that assesses your understanding of essential insurance concepts and regulations. This exam is a crucial step for anyone aspiring to operate in the Massachusetts life insurance industry.

Exam Format

The Massachusetts Life Producer Exam is structured to gauge your proficiency in various aspects of life insurance. The exam format is primarily multiple-choice, offering four answer choices for each question. Here's what you need to know:

  • Total Questions: The exam typically comprises around 100-150 questions.
  • Duration: You are given approximately 2 hours to complete the exam.
  • Passing Score: A minimum score of 70% is generally required to pass, although this may vary slightly based on specific exam iterations.
  • Exam Sections: The test is divided into sections covering diverse topics related to life insurance.

What to Expect on the Exam

The Massachusetts Life Producer Exam is comprehensive, covering a range of subject matter that reflects real-world scenarios and regulatory aspects of life insurance. Topics you can expect include:

  • Basic Life Insurance Concepts: Understand the fundamentals of life insurance, including types of policies and coverage options.
  • Insurance Regulations: Familiarize yourself with both state and federal regulations that pertain to life insurance operations in Massachusetts.
  • Policy Provisions and Options: Gain insights into policy structures, options, benefits, and riders.
  • Underwriting and Policy Issue: Grasp the concepts of risk assessment, underwriting standards, and how policies are issued.
  • Annuities: Learn about different annuity products, their characteristics, and how they fit into retirement planning.
  • Customer Needs Analysis: Understand how to evaluate and address the insurance needs of different clients.

Tips for Passing the Massachusetts Life Producer Exam

Preparing for the Life Producer Exam requires dedication and strategic study. Here are some tips to enhance your preparation:

  1. Utilize Quality Study Resources: Leverage various study materials such as textbooks, online courses, and practice exams. The blend of text and interactive content caters to different learning styles.

  2. Regular Practice with Flashcards: Flashcards are an effective tool for memorizing terms and definitions. Utilize digital flashcards for on-the-go study sessions.

  3. Join Study Groups: Collaborate with peers preparing for the same exam. Group study sessions can provide new insights and clarify doubts.

  4. Take Practice Exams: Simulate exam conditions by completing full-length practice tests. This helps you gauge your preparation level and identify areas requiring more focus.

  5. Review Policy Documents: Familiarize yourself with policy documents and their clauses to understand real-use terms and conditions.

  6. Focus on Weak Subject Areas: Identify and concentrate on your weaker topics. Allocate time to revisit these areas until you gain confidence.

  7. Stay Updated on Changes: Insurance laws and question formats can change. Keep abreast of any updates applicable to your exam.
